FACTORS AFFECTING ELECTRIC SHOCK

1. AMOUNT OF CURRENT THAT HAS PASSED THRU THE BODY.


2. PATH OF ELECTRIC CURRENT THRU THE BODY.


3. LENGTH OF TIME THE CURRENT IS PASSING THRU THE BODY.


4. FREQUECY OF THE CURRENT AND PHASE OF THE HEART CYCLE WHEN SHOCK OCCUR.


5. PHYSICAL AND PHYSIOLOGICAL CONDITION OF THE BODY.

FACTORS INFLUENCING CONDUCTOR RESISTANCE


1. COMPOSITION OF THE CONDUCTOR


2. LENGTH OF THE WIRE


3. CROSS SECTIONAL AREA OF THE WIRE


4. TEMPERATURE
